The 1991's came with the older 6.2L IDI NA diesel. I know because I have that exact truck in the same color. Badge says GMC though. You can add a Banks Turbo (I did) but it's neither cheap nor a breeze. However, if you are in a truck happy place like Texas you stand a better chance at finding a used Banks unit on the cheap. Also, I'd recommend using a waste-gated turbo from the Banks kit for the Powerstroke 7.3 IDI. Mates up well and gives better power down low, which has been my only complaint on my turbo.
